问题标签 [oracle-service-bus]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
51 浏览

sql - Oracle SQL 中缺少 IN 或 OUT 参数

我在这部分 SQL{“U”=UPPER(:codigo)} 上遇到错误。当我删除变量和硬编码 :codigo as u 或 U 时,它工作正常。我收到的错误是缺少输入或输出参数。我在 Oracle 12c 服务总线上收到此错误

完整的 SQL:

0 投票
0 回答
27 浏览

oracle-service-bus - OSB 12c 未使用 DB 适配器业务服务更新表

场景:数据库适配器将从表 X 中轮询并将轮询列更新为“正在处理”(工作正常。没有问题)。轮询记录必须通过 Web 服务调用保存到数据库(工作正常。没有问题)。如果将数据保存到数据库表 X 必须使用“SubmissionSuccess”列更新,否则“SubmissionFailed”使用过程/pureSQl 更新(此更新“SubmissionFailed”/“SubmissionSuccess”不更新)。数据源类型:XA 事务注意:所有 3 个步骤(轮询、Web 服务调用、DB 调用)均在单个管道中实现

0 投票
0 回答
31 浏览

oracle19c - 未在 OSB 12c Fusion MiddleWare 中使用 DB 适配器更新表

在 OSB 流中,代理服务 (DBAdapter) 将轮询(在轮询期间,状态“已批准”将更改为“提交”)来自 DB 的记录。轮询完成后,记录将被提交(使用 PLSQL 过程,DBAdapter)到另一个表,如果提交到另一个表成功:“提交”中的状态(使用 PLSQL 过程,DBAdapter)应该更新为“已提交”如果失败,则应将其更新为“提交失败”。在我的流程中,我可以在轮询期间将状态从“已批准”更改为“提交中”。但在那之后,将同一列从 'Submitting' 更新为 'Submitted' 或 'SubmissionFailed' 并没有发生。我什至没有在日志中看到任何错误。注意:整个过程在一个管道中完成,并使用 XA Transaction。

0 投票
1 回答
38 浏览

oracle12c - BEA-382501 业务服务向代理服务返回无法识别的响应

我知道我的问题可能是重复的,但我被卡住了。

我有一个将 POST 发送到端点的 REST 业务服务。使用 200 响应测试它可以正常工作。

我的管道执行一个服务调用,作为回报从端点获得 200 响应,但向管道返回 BEA-382501 故障。

“使用分块流模式”已禁用!

0 投票
0 回答
14 浏览

oracle - Oracle 服务总线/XSL 映射/附加源

有人可以帮助我使用Oracle 服务总线 12C吗?我添加XSL MAP,指定源模式、目标模式和另一个模式作为附加源(参数)。

在设计中,我将源标签与目标模式相关联。测试时出现问题。对指定为附加且必须通过参数访问的模式的所有调用都将被完全忽略。

你能告诉我可能是什么问题吗?

XSLT 调用示例

0 投票
0 回答
22 浏览

oracle - 我们如何使用 xs:base64Binary($arg as xs:anyAtomicType?) as xs:base64Binary?in osb 12 c

xs:base64Binary($arg as xs:anyAtomicType?) as xs:base64Binary 有什么用